//! Piping output from one command into another command:
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! ```
|
||||
//! use std::process::{Command, Stdio};
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! // stdout must be configured with `Stdio::piped` in order to use
|
||||
//! // `echo_child.stdout`
|
||||
//! let echo_child = Command::new("echo")
|
||||
//! .arg("Oh no, a tpyo!")
|
||||
//! .stdout(Stdio::piped())
|
||||
//! .spawn()
|
||||
//! .expect("Failed to start echo process");
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! // Note that `echo_child` is moved here, but we won't be needing
|
||||
//! // `echo_child` anymore
|
||||
//! let echo_out = echo_child.stdout.expect("Failed to open echo stdout");
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! let mut sed_child = Command::new("sed")
|
||||
//! .arg("s/tpyo/typo/")
|
||||
//! .stdin(Stdio::from(echo_out))
|
||||
//! .stdout(Stdio::piped())
|
||||
//! .spawn()
|
||||
//! .expect("Failed to start sed process");
|
||||
//!
|
||||
//! let output = sed_child.wait_with_output().expect("Failed to wait on sed");
|
||||
//! assert_eq!(b"Oh no, a typo!\n", output.stdout.as_slice());
|
||||
//! ```
